To get the most accurate reading, place the calibrated thermometer in the middle of the refrigerator, away from the walls and any food items. This location will provide a more average temperature reading, giving you a better sense of the overall temperature inside the refrigerator.

Measuring the ambient temperature of the frozen food compartment does not accurately reflect the temperature of the frozen food products themselves, as the air temperature can differ from the temperature of the food items. It is best to use a thermometer to measure the temperature of the food directly for a more accurate assessment of its safety and quality.

The most accurate method for measuring air temperature is using a high-quality digital thermometer placed in a shaded area away from direct sunlight and heat sources.

To use a food temperature probe, first ensure it is clean and calibrated. Insert the probe into the thickest part of the food, avoiding bone or fat, to get an accurate reading. Wait for a few seconds until the temperature stabilizes, then check the display for the internal temperature. Ensure the food reaches the recommended safe cooking temperature for optimal safety and quality.
